
The Utah Valley University School of Education thanks you for your generous support throughout the EverGREEN campaign. From 2018 to 2025, 373 donors have contributed $6,519,078, demonstrating an inspiring commitment to the future of education at UVU and beyond.
Because of you, future teachers, counselors, and education professionals studying at UVU are gaining the confidence, skills, and hands-on experience they need to step into classrooms and schools ready to make a difference. Your generosity strengthens every program, from Wolverines Elevated to the McKay Education Building expansion to the many initiatives that give students real world practice, mentorship, and opportunities to serve.
